Recording movies
You can record movies on a tape or a
“Memory Stick Duo.”
Before recording, follow steps 1 to 7 in
“Getting started”(p. 12 - p. 20).
When you are recording on a tape, movies
will be recorded along with stereo sound.
When you are recording on a “Memory Stick
Duo,” the movie will be recorded with
monaural sound.
1 Open the LCD panel.
2 Select the recording mode.
To record on a tape
Slide the POWER switch until the
CAMERA-TAPE lamp lights up. The lens
cover opens, and your camcorder is set to
the standby mode.
To record on a “Memory Stick
Duo” — MPEG MOVIE AX
Slide the POWER switch repeatedly until
the CAMERA-MEM lamp lights up. The
lens cover opens, and the currently selected
recording folder appears on the screen.
3 Press START/STOP.
Recording starts. [REC] appears on the
LCD screen and the Camera recording lamp
lights up.
Press START/STOP. Recording stops.
To check the last recorded MPEG movie
— Review
Touch . Playback automatically starts.
Touch to return to the standby mode.
To delete a movie, touch after playback is
finished, then touch [YES].
To cancel the operation, touch [NO].
To turn the power off
Slide the POWER switch up to (CHG)OFF.
Indicators displayed during recording
on a tape
The indicators will not be recorded on the tape.
Date/time and camera settings data (p. 43) will
not be displayed during recording.
A Remaining battery time
The indicated time may not be correct
depending on the environment of use.
When you opened or closed the LCD panel,
it takes about 1 minute to display the correct
remaining battery time.
